Eminem Talks About "Relapse"


For those who haven't heard, Eminem has been back in the lab, hard at work at planning his big comeback for 2009 with his new album, "Relapse." The album is set to be released around Spring 09, and is said to be a throwback to the good ol' days with legendary producer Dr. Dre.

Eminem recently sent an e-mail to Billboard, and spoke a little about the new album.

Here are some highlights:

"Me and Dre are back in the lab like the old days, man." "Just him banging away on tracks and me getting that little spark that makes me write to it. I don't have chemistry like that with anyone else as far as producers go — not even close. Dre will end up producing the majority of the tracks on Relapse. We are up to our old mischievous ways. ... Let's just leave it at that."

He also spoke about the leaked tracks that have recently surfaced online:

"It wasn't close to finished, and it even has me doing guide vocals for Dre as a suggestion of how he could lay his verses down." It's like someone catches you peeping in your window before you got the Spider Man costume all zipped up! Nobody is supposed to see that. We are gonna finish it up, though, and get it out there how it's supposed to be."

Eminem also denies the reports about a "Stan Part2," which producer Swizz Beatz claimed was going to happen.

Eminem x Marvel: The Punisher


In light of Eminem's big return to hip-hop, XXL has teamed up with him and Marvel Comics to give you, "The Punisher." The first 8 pages of the story will be featured in XXL's June issue. The 8 remaining pages will be available for free at Marvel Digital Comics starting today!

Eminem Graces The Cover Of VIBE Magazine


This issue dives into some of Marshal Mathers' most personal and deepest issues. Issues like drug addiction, and how he almost ended his life while taking all sorts of pillsare dicussed in the magazine.
